Fixed Operations Director at Morgan Auto Group

A Fixed Operations Director leads the service, parts, and collision departments at a car dealership. This leader sets budgets, builds efficient workflows, and drives back-end profit. They mentor managers instead of fixing cars.

  • Role Summary
  • Job Title: Fixed Operations Director
  • Department: Fixed Operations (Service, Parts, Body Shop)
  • Reports To: General Manager

Key Responsibilities

  • Financial Management: Build annual budgets. Track profit margins, labor rates, and parts inventory turnover. Maximize service absorption to cover dealership overhead.
  • Team Leadership: Hire, train, and mentor service and parts managers. Run regular leadership meetings. Foster teamwork across departments.
  • Process Improvement: Create systems that speed up repairs and reduce customer complaints. Oversee adoption of new shop technology.
  • Compliance & Standards: Ensure adherence to factory warranty policies. Keep the shop safe and compliant with OSHA and environmental rules.
  • Customer Retention: Track Customer Satisfaction Scores (CSI). Build programs that bring car owners back for regular service.
  • Qualifications
  • Experience: 5+ years in dealership management (Service Manager or Parts Manager).
  • Skills: Strong financial literacy, data analysis, and team leadership.
  • Knowledge: Deep understanding of automotive repair workflows, warranty administration, and inventory systems.
